How mail tracking number Actually Works
mail tracking number uses a complex system of digital data and automated updates to provide accurate, up-to-the-minute information about the location of your package. Essentially, whenever a package is sent out, a unique tracking number is generated, which contains details about the item's dimensions, packaging, and shipping route. At each transfer point (e.g., sorting facilities, post offices), this tracking information is automatically recorded and updated, making it possible for you to monitor your package's journey in real time.

What Is a mail tracking number?
A mail tracking number is an unique code assigned to a package, used to track its movement and status during the shipping process.
How Long Does It Take to Get a mail tracking number?
In most cases, you'll receive the tracking number from the seller or shipping provider within a day or two after placing your order.
